The Settings Dialog

 

 

System

Use the System menu to configure system and network parameters.

General

Figure 11 shows the System General menu for the system configuration. Use this menu to change voicemail, auto answer, and auto dial settings. Detailed information on these configuration options is listed below. When the information is complete, select OK to save the settings.

Figure 11. System General Menu

Voicemail

Specify the amount of time in milliseconds before a call is sent to voicemail.

Auto Answer

Specify the time in seconds before the Auto Answer (AA) feature answers a call.

Auto Dial

Check this box to enable auto dialing after a certain time span. If you are not able to dial the number before the ADTRAN IP SoftPhone starts dialing, uncheck this box.

Build Information

The product version of the ADTRAN IP SoftPhone is displayed here. Technical Support may ask for this value to identify the appropriate softphone version.
